Shifting focus, recent updates on LinkedIn have unveiled a commitment to building a more robust professional community. The introduction of ‘LinkedIn Stories’ mirrors other platforms but with a professional twist, offering networking opportunities for users showcasing their work in a more casual format. This avenue opens up substantial engagement channels, allowing brands to connect authentically with their audiences. Furthermore, LinkedIn has also enhanced its learning platform, integrating courses into user feeds. This addition showcases LinkedIn’s focus on skill development and positioning itself as more than a job board. For companies, a strong emphasis should be placed on crafting engaging stories. Another notable update comes from Snapchat, where innovative features are regularly introduced to enhance user engagement. The platform has released new AR lenses that not only entertain but also offer brands unique ways to interact with their audience. These updates allow for immersive experiences with advertising, rendering traditional static ads less effective. Companies aiming to connect with younger demographics can leverage these features creatively to produce captivating campaigns leading to improved engagement. Additionally, Snapchat has optimized its Discover section, making it more accessible and appealing. Tweaks in advertisement formats highlight video content, catering to the shift towards dynamic storytelling. This approach rewards brands willing to explore outside conventional advertising methods. Moreover, interactive polls and Q&A features elevate user interaction, ultimately bridging communication gaps. Lastly, Twitter has undergone profound adjustments with its focus on enhancing user experience, particularly through its revamped interface. The introduction of Spaces for audio conversations resonates with trends towards more interactive media; this development symbolizes a launch into the audio content market similar to podcasting. Brands can utilize Spaces to conduct discussions and share insights, tapping into a live audience. Notably, Twitter has optimized tweet visibility, aiming for increased reach on posts derived from authentic engagement. Enhanced metrics and analytics will offer valuable insights into tweet performance, directing brands towards what resonates with followers. Engagement through polls and hashtags are now more emphasized, driving discussions around trending topics.
